WebThe Undercover Guidelines prescribe the authority level and approval process for FBI undercover operations based upon the type of undercover operation being proposed. Except pursuant to the limited circumstances described in Section I below, only the Director, Deputy Director, or Associate Deputy Director-Investigations may approve a proposed operation if a reasonable expectation exists that: (1) The undercover operation will be used to participate in the activities of a group under investigation as part of a Domestic Security Investigation or to recruit a person from within such a group as an informant or confidential source (Sensitive Circumstance (1)); (2) There may be a significant risk of violence or personal injury to individuals or a significant risk of financial loss (Sensitive Circumstance (m)). (1) An undercover operation approved by FBIHQ may not continue longer than is necessary to achieve the objectives specified in the authorization, nor in any event longer than six months, without new authorization to proceed, except pursuant to subparagraph (3) below.
